SQL面试必会6题经典以及Oracle必问的面试题
在SQL面试中,一些经典问题经常出现。这些问题可以让你体现出你对SQL的理解和应用能力,也可以让你展示你的解决问题的能力。在Oracle面试中,这些问题同样也经常被提出。以下是SQL面试必会的6个经典问题和Oracle必问的面试题:
问题一:在SQL中,如何删除重复的行?
如果你需要在SQL中删除数据库表中的重复记录,你可以使用DISTINCT来执行这项操作。此外,你还可以使用GROUP BY和HAVING语句来删除重复行。
问题二:SQL中JOIN的作用是什么?
JOIN是SQL中用于将两个或多个表中的数据合并在一起的关键字。它可以帮助你将数据从一个表中链接到另一个表中,这样你可以用更强大的查询来操作这些表。
问题三:如何使用SQL进行数据分析?
数据分析是SQL的一个重要应用领域。你可以使用SQL来执行聚合函数、排序和分组,进行数据透视表分析等。
问题四:在Oracle中如何创建一个表?
在Oracle中,你可以使用CREATE TABLE语句来创建一个表。这个语句包括表名、列名和列数据类型等详细信息。
问题五:如何在Oracle中修改一个表?
如果你需要修改Oracle数据库表的结构或数据,你可以使用ALTER TABLE语句。这个语句可以帮助你添加、删除和修改表的列名、数据类型和约束等。
问题六:如何使用SQL进行数据备份和还原?
在SQL中,你可以使用备份和还原操作来保护和恢复你的数据。你可以使用BACKUP DATABASE和RESTORE DATABASE命令来备份和还原数据库。
综上所述,以上是SQL面试必会6题经典以及Oracle必问的面试题。精通这些问题不仅有助于你在面试中脱颖而出,也能使你在日常工作中处理数据更加高效。
0